Togbi Tenge Dzokoto urges calm as floodgate opens to ease flood in Keta Municipality

Mr Wisdom Seade, the Keta Municipal Chief Executive, in an interview with the GNA, commended the chiefs, stakeholders, engineers, the VRA technical team, the media and the entire community for their various roles in ensuring the successful opening of the floodgate to alleviate the flooding situation in the three municipalities, namely Ketu South, Anloga and Keta.

He further advised the affected victims to remain patient while the engineers and the technical team from the VRA, who were responsible for opening the floodgates, monitored the water level and closed the gates when necessary to avoid any further unfortunate situations.

Meanwhile, Engineer Rex Edeckor, speaking during a stakeholders’ engagement meeting held at the Keta Municipal Assembly, said the opening of the floodgate had already begun yielding positive results, with water levels receding in many of the affected communities, such as Anyako, Atiavi-Glime, Fiaxor and Shime, among others.
